- (continued from previous page)class used to go inside the desks then and do a composition. After that they would do arithmetic. They would be at that for a half-hour. Then they would be let out to lunch. After lunch when they would come in they would be taught agriculture for a half-hour. After that they would be taught Euclid and mensuration. It would take an hour to teach all that. Then the next subject was book-keeping and a half-hour was spent at that. After that parsing and geography between them took up an hour.
The last thing of all was Bible and Catechism for a(continues on next page)- Collector
